Delve into 'Stereophonic' at London's Duke of York's Theatre, a captivating production exploring the intricacies of a 1970s rock band on the cusp of stardom. The Duke of York's Theatre, a historic venue in the heart of London's West End, offers an intimate setting for this compelling drama. London, a city renowned for its vibrant arts scene and theatrical heritage, provides the perfect backdrop. With a seating capacity of just over 1,000, the theatre ensures an immersive experience. Expect an engaging story of creative clashes, personal struggles, and the relentless pursuit of musical greatness.

Sentiment Analysis
Overall sentiment is positive. Many critics praise the show for its authentic portrayal of band life and strong performances, while some find the pacing slow. A compelling production for those interested in music history.

Praised for its realistic portrayal of band dynamics.
Spectacular performances by the cast.
Immersive and engaging storyline.
Stunning set design and attention to detail.
Some found the plot slow-paced.
Certain viewers felt the characters were underdeveloped.
